The differences that legality of prostitution would make can be observed by travelling.I watched women in countries with legalized prostitution carry on their trades in a fearless and safe manner. As I travelled south, I was treated to the sort of sights I witness back home. Women slinking around the dark streets of factory districts. They are more vulnerable. Their clients are more vulnerable. It is not an ideal position in a person's life, but it has always been. Legality, as if there should be a question, only makes the situation worse. Any underground trade is dangerous, and this one is particularly so.
In the end, the act is one between two consenting adults. To intervene is a violation of personal autonomy.
